MAQUOKETA, Iowa -- For the second time in 10 days, a person has died in a crash at U.S. 61 and Hurstville Road, just north of Maquoketa.
Jackson County Sheriff deputies said Clifford Daniels, 78, of Miles, died at Jackson County Regional Health Center from injuries he suffered in a two-vehicle accident at 8:29 p.m. Friday.
Another Maquoketa woman, Lois Potter also died in a two-vehicle accident on Nov. 20 at the same intersection.
Deputies said Jeffrey Dellitt, 42 of Bettendorf was driving a 2001 GMC Yukon north on U.S. 61 in the left lane. Daniels was on Hurstville Road driving a 1998 Plymouth Voyager and pulled out in front of the Dellitts vehicle and the two collided.
